## Releases

Starting with v4.2, Textrill runs encoding detection on every uploaded text file before ingest. The detector samples the first 64 KB, scores UTF-8, UTF-16, and legacy codepages, and tags the release artifact with the winning encoding. Files below the confidence threshold are quarantined for manual review by the Marloweby team. Release bundles including the detector model are signed before publish, and verification uses the key below.

deploy key for kajof-fajop: bky6_gDHw9Q

### CI Troubleshooting: Plugin builds failing on Renderhive

If your transcoder plugin fails in the Renderhive CI farm with codec-probe timeouts, it's usually the sandbox image, not your code. We rotated base images last week and a few workers still cache the old one. Re-run once; if it fails twice, pin your manifest to the `hive-2` pool. When filing a report, include the exact build token, which you'll find appended below.

pipeline stamp: htk9_ce63042d9

Action item from the Lanthorn rate-parity incident: the checker silently skipped properties when the Quillon feed returned partial results, so we flew blind on mismatches for three days. Fix is twofold — fail loudly on partial feeds, and add a coverage metric to the release checklist so you can eyeball it before sign-off. Tasha's got the alerting piece; the parser patch ships with next week's train. Please hold the release if coverage dips below 95%. Checklist and dashboard are at the page below.

wiki page, tahaf-tajog: https://jira.ordindyn.corp/pipeline